Урок 138. Определение местоположения. GPS координаты.
Re: Урок 138. Определение местоположения. GPS координаты.
Еле зарегистрировался,
написать в нужном разделе форума не получается, доступ ограничен.
У меня есть вопрос, и предложение по работе за деньги или долевое участие, ищу специалиста в области SEO , создания приложения с использованием локации или без нее если такое возможно,
все подробности в личку или по тел 89651525662
написать в нужном разделе форума не получается, доступ ограничен.
У меня есть вопрос, и предложение по работе за деньги или долевое участие, ищу специалиста в области SEO , создания приложения с использованием локации или без нее если такое возможно,
все подробности в личку или по тел 89651525662
Re: Урок 138. Определение местоположения. GPS координаты.
Вообще я повис. Т.е. вы хотите, чтобы специалист по продвижению сайтов написал вам Android приложение? Боюсь вам придется платить за его обучение разработке, или же учить программиста быть SEO шником. Android мало относится к веб, чтобы тут жили гуру расположения слов на странице...ищу специалиста в области SEO
- Mikhail_dev
- Сообщения: 2386
- Зарегистрирован: 09 янв 2012, 14:45
- Откуда: Самара
-
- Сообщения: 2
- Зарегистрирован: 11 фев 2014, 17:39
Re: Урок 138. Определение местоположения. GPS координаты.
При запуске вашего приложения на эмуляторе windroy оно вылетает, на avd проверить не могу оно сильно тормозит,подскажите в чем может быть проблема
- Mikhail_dev
- Сообщения: 2386
- Зарегистрирован: 09 янв 2012, 14:45
- Откуда: Самара
Re: Урок 138. Определение местоположения. GPS координаты.
Спросите на канале НТВ, там частенько идет битва экстрасенсов.
Re: Урок 138. Определение местоположения. GPS координаты.
вероятно на этом непонятном эмуляторе нет googleApi,roganov_igor писал(а):При запуске вашего приложения на эмуляторе windroy оно вылетает, на avd проверить не могу оно сильно тормозит,подскажите в чем может быть проблема
но я это так наугад ляпнул
Re: Урок 138. Определение местоположения. GPS координаты.
на ТНТ же) ну и на канал никто не пустит, но там тоже есть форум)m090050 писал(а):Спросите на канале НТВ, там частенько идет битва экстрасенсов.
-
- Сообщения: 2
- Зарегистрирован: 11 фев 2014, 17:39
Re: Урок 138. Определение местоположения. GPS координаты.
получилось запустить на avd , но там ошибка unfortunately, name_project has stopped
Re: Урок 138. Определение местоположения. GPS координаты.
ну зачем грубить то?roganov_igor писал(а):Два *цензура* klblk,m090050 отпускают свои тупые шутки. Ну если нечего написать зачем писать такую *цензура*. Ой наверно меня сейчас забанят,как жаль.
Вы сами себе не хотите помочь. Будут логи ошибки, вероятно будет решение. В противном случае никто помочь не сможет
Re: Урок 138. Определение местоположения. GPS координаты.
У меня установлена программа Dive Log, в ней есть функция определения текущих GPS координат по нажатию кнопки. Так вот координаты определяются даже при выключенном интернете и GPS(в настройках). Как такое может быть?
- Mikhail_dev
- Сообщения: 2386
- Зарегистрирован: 09 янв 2012, 14:45
- Откуда: Самара
Re: Урок 138. Определение местоположения. GPS координаты.
[syntax=java]
@Override
public void onProviderDisabled(String provider) {
boolean enabledOnly = true;
locationManager.getProviders(enabledOnly);
checkEnabled();
}
[/syntax]
Написал так чтобы если выключен gps, то включил. и включается. но в настройках gps есть внизу еще одна галочка, где написано поиск гугла, если там галочка стоит то gps включается, а если не стоит то пусто. В коде поменял немного, оставил только gps а network отключил и функции все. может если будет включен то сработает. Или же подскажите как программно включить вторую галочку поиск гугла. и еще есть такой код
[syntax=java5]
TelephonyManager tm = (TelephonyManager) getSystemService(Context.TELEPHONY_SERVICE);
device_id = tm.getDeviceId(); // IMEI
phoneNumber = tm.getLine1Number(); // номер телефона по формату +xxxxxxxxxxxx
// псевдо ид
pseudoID = 35 +
Build.BOARD.length()%10 + Build.BRAND.length()%10 +
Build.CPU_ABI.length()%10 + Build.DEVICE.length()%10 +
Build.DISPLAY.length()%10 + Build.HOST.length()%10 +
Build.ID.length()%10 + Build.MANUFACTURER.length()%10 +
Build.MODEL.length()%10 + Build.PRODUCT.length()%10 +
Build.TAGS.length()%10 + Build.TYPE.length()%10 +
Build.USER.length()%10;
[/syntax]
IMEI код находит, но номер телефона возвращает null а псевдоид и на эмуляторе и на телефоне выводит 111, но должен длинное число выводить.
@Override
public void onProviderDisabled(String provider) {
boolean enabledOnly = true;
locationManager.getProviders(enabledOnly);
checkEnabled();
}
[/syntax]
Написал так чтобы если выключен gps, то включил. и включается. но в настройках gps есть внизу еще одна галочка, где написано поиск гугла, если там галочка стоит то gps включается, а если не стоит то пусто. В коде поменял немного, оставил только gps а network отключил и функции все. может если будет включен то сработает. Или же подскажите как программно включить вторую галочку поиск гугла. и еще есть такой код
[syntax=java5]
TelephonyManager tm = (TelephonyManager) getSystemService(Context.TELEPHONY_SERVICE);
device_id = tm.getDeviceId(); // IMEI
phoneNumber = tm.getLine1Number(); // номер телефона по формату +xxxxxxxxxxxx
// псевдо ид
pseudoID = 35 +
Build.BOARD.length()%10 + Build.BRAND.length()%10 +
Build.CPU_ABI.length()%10 + Build.DEVICE.length()%10 +
Build.DISPLAY.length()%10 + Build.HOST.length()%10 +
Build.ID.length()%10 + Build.MANUFACTURER.length()%10 +
Build.MODEL.length()%10 + Build.PRODUCT.length()%10 +
Build.TAGS.length()%10 + Build.TYPE.length()%10 +
Build.USER.length()%10;
[/syntax]
IMEI код находит, но номер телефона возвращает null а псевдоид и на эмуляторе и на телефоне выводит 111, но должен длинное число выводить.
Re: Урок 138. Определение местоположения. GPS координаты.
G_O_R писал(а):[syntax=java]
@Override
public void onProviderDisabled(String provider) {
boolean enabledOnly = true;
locationManager.getProviders(enabledOnly);
checkEnabled();
}
[/syntax]
Написал так чтобы если выключен gps, то включил. и включается. но в настройках gps есть внизу еще одна галочка, где написано поиск гугла, если там галочка стоит то gps включается, а если не стоит то пусто. В коде поменял немного, оставил только gps а network отключил и функции все. может если будет включен то сработает. Или же подскажите как программно включить вторую галочку поиск гугла. и еще есть такой код
[syntax=java5]
TelephonyManager tm = (TelephonyManager) getSystemService(Context.TELEPHONY_SERVICE);
device_id = tm.getDeviceId(); // IMEI
phoneNumber = tm.getLine1Number(); // номер телефона по формату +xxxxxxxxxxxx
// псевдо ид
pseudoID = 35 +
Build.BOARD.length()%10 + Build.BRAND.length()%10 +
Build.CPU_ABI.length()%10 + Build.DEVICE.length()%10 +
Build.DISPLAY.length()%10 + Build.HOST.length()%10 +
Build.ID.length()%10 + Build.MANUFACTURER.length()%10 +
Build.MODEL.length()%10 + Build.PRODUCT.length()%10 +
Build.TAGS.length()%10 + Build.TYPE.length()%10 +
Build.USER.length()%10;
[/syntax]
IMEI код находит, но номер телефона возвращает null а псевдоид и на эмуляторе и на телефоне выводит 111, но должен длинное число выводить.
не то. думал из галочки поиска. объяснили неправильно или я не понял правильно. там галочку включения gps вставили и тогда срабатывало.
Может кто нибудь подсказать как в программе включить и отключить gps ???
Re: Урок 138. Определение местоположения. GPS координаты.
Всем доброго дня, взял код из урока, добавил его, но у меня почему-то метод onLocationChanged ни разу не вызвался, в чем может быть беда?
- Mikhail_dev
- Сообщения: 2386
- Зарегистрирован: 09 янв 2012, 14:45
- Откуда: Самара
Re: Урок 138. Определение местоположения. GPS координаты.
Отключен GPS и Network. И в манифест все добавили?
Re: Урок 138. Определение местоположения. GPS координаты.
Так в том то и беда, что и дпс и нетворк включены, в манифест добавил следующее
<uses-permission android:name="android.permission.INTERNET"></uses-permission>
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"></uses-permission>
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"></uses-permission>
<uses-permission android:name="com.google.android.providers.gsf.permission.READ_GSERVICES"></uses-permission>
<u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ION"></uses-permission>
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ION"></uses-permission>
еще могут быть какие-то варианты?
<uses-permission android:name="android.permission.INTERNET"></uses-permission>
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E"></uses-permission>
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"></uses-permission>
<uses-permission android:name="com.google.android.providers.gsf.permission.READ_GSERVICES"></uses-permission>
<u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ION"></uses-permission>
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ION"></uses-permission>
еще могут быть какие-то варианты?
- Mikhail_dev
- Сообщения: 2386
- Зарегистрирован: 09 янв 2012, 14:45
- Откуда: Самара
Re: Урок 138. Определение местоположения. GPS координаты.
Неправильно написано приложение как вариант. Тут надо код смотреть.
Re: Урок 138. Определение местоположения. GPS координаты.
Код взят из урока 138, один в один. Могу на гидхаб выложить.
- Mikhail_dev
- Сообщения: 2386
- Зарегистрирован: 09 янв 2012, 14:45
- Откуда: Самара
Re: Урок 138. Определение местоположения. GPS координаты.
https://github.com/ErrorPro/Android вот ссылка, на проект